Matrix Metalloproteinase 9 (MMP9) BioAssay™ ELISA Kit (Horse) is a Sandwich enzyme immunoassay. The microtiter plate provided in this kit has been pre-coated with an antibody specific to Matrix Metalloproteinase 9 (MMP9). Standards or samples are then added to the appropriate microtiter plate wells with a biotin-conjugated antibody specific to Matrix Metalloproteinase 9 (MMP9). Next, Avidin conjugated to Horseradish Peroxidase (HRP) is added to each microplate well and incubated. After TMB substrate solution is added, only those wells that contain Matrix Metalloproteinase 9 (MMP9), biotin-conjugated antibody and enzyme-conjugated Avidin will exhibit a change in color. The enzyme-substrate reaction is terminated by the addition of sulphuric acid solution and the color change is measured spectrophotometrically at a wavelength of 450nm±10nm. The concentration of Matrix Metalloproteinase 9 (MMP9) in the samples is then determined by comparing the O.D. of the samples to the standard curve.
